What is US Beef Stock?

US beef stock is a flavorful liquid made from simmering beef bones, meat, vegetables, and herbs. It serves as the foundation for soups, sauces, stews, and more, adding depth and richness to any dish. Unlike water, which lacks flavor, beef stock is packed with umami, giving your meals that sought-after "umph."

How to Make US Beef Stock

To create your own homemade beef stock, follow these simple steps:

  1. Gather Ingredients: You'll need beef bones, vegetables (carrots, celery, onions), herbs (thyme, bay leaves), and water.
  2. Roast the Bones: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and roast the beef bones until they are well-browned.
  3. Simmer: Place the roasted bones, vegetables, and herbs in a large pot. Add water, and bring to a boil. Then, reduce the heat and simmer for 6-8 hours.
  4. Strain: Once the stock has cooled, strain it through a fine-mesh sieve or cheesecloth to remove any impurities.
  5. Store: Allow the stock to cool, then refrigerate or freeze it for future use.
